    Draymond Green is partying like the Golden State Warriors won a championship, but they didn't. Perhaps he's celebrating his friend LeBron James' gold medal success after the Paris Olympics. Green has become close with James since signing with Klutch Sports, a James-affiliated management company. As the two stars decompress after vastly different seasons, both hope for an improved 2024-25 season.

    Where did the two NBA championship buddies go this time?

    The location is unknown, but James posted the aftermath of the seven red wine bottles they destroyed. James sent Green an Instagram story with the caption, "Was one of those nights!"

    James, Rich Paul, Mav Carter, and Green spent the night dancing and drinking. Perhaps it was an extended celebration of James winning a gold medal. It could have been a Klutch Sports-related night, considering Paul and Carter's presence.

    Regardless of the reason, the gentlemen appeared to be having fun on the dance floor with Green sweating like it was Game 7 of the 2016 NBA Finals.

    Green and James have plenty of distractions throughout their busy lives, and NBA training camp is coming soon, leading to a necessary night of luxurious drinking.

    Green's Warriors seek a playoff bid after missing the playoffs for the third time since 2020. Meanwhile, James' Los Angeles Lakers look to advance past the first round of the playoffs following a 4-1 loss to the Denver Nuggets.
